I have had to come up with a script for when I use Copilot, or any other AI for that matter. I copy and paste it into the chat every single time I open it up and begin to use it. Because it will forget and go back to its baser programming every time. It likes to make excuses too. Here is a version of it that I found is helpful, but I have different ones for what I am asking it to do each time. --- "Support my ideas before expanding them. Do not turn simple concepts into larger systems, frameworks, simulations, life lessons, or analyses unless I explicitly ask. Answer the specific thing I asked first. Keep responses concise. Avoid interpreting my emotions, motivations, thought processes, or personal growth. Avoid summarizing me back to myself. Avoid telling me what I really mean. Provide practical support, feedback, and planning help." --- Because without these scripts it's like training a puppy to go to the bathroom on the paper and not to chew my shoes every single time, and it's frustrating and time consuming
